H A D | drm_atomic_helper.h | 28500291 Fri Aug 26 02:30:39 CDT 2016 Liu Ying <gnuiyl@gmail.com> drm/atomic-helper: Disable appropriate planes in disable_planes_on_crtc()
Currently, the helper drm_atomic_helper_disable_planes_on_crtc() calls ->atomic_disable for all planes _to be_ enabled on a particular CRTC. This is obviously wrong for those planes which are not scanning out frames when the helper is called. Instead, it's sane to disable active planes of old_crtc_state in the helper.
